Richard G. Hennig is a scholar working on Materials Chemistry, Electrical and Electronic Engineering and Atomic and Molecular Physics, and Optics.
According to data from OpenAlex, Richard G. Hennig has authored 193 papers receiving a total of 14.0k indexed citations (citations by other indexed papers that have themselves been cited), including 141 papers in Materials Chemistry, 52 papers in Electrical and Electronic Engineering and 38 papers in Atomic and Molecular Physics, and Optics. Recurrent topics in Richard G. Hennig’s work include 2D Materials and Applications (47 papers), Machine Learning in Materials Science (28 papers) and MXene and MAX Phase Materials (25 papers). Richard G. Hennig is often cited by papers focused on 2D Materials and Applications (47 papers), Machine Learning in Materials Science (28 papers) and MXene and MAX Phase Materials (25 papers). Richard G. Hennig collaborates with scholars based in United States, Germany and Switzerland. Richard G. Hennig's co-authors include Houlong Zhuang, Arunima K. Singh, Kiran Mathew, Susan B. Sinnott and John W. Wilkins and has published in prestigious journals such as Nature, Science and Physical Review Letters.
